Overview

Randstad CPE are currently recruiting for a PTS Site engineer for a Rail civils project in Sizewell. Immediate start!

Job Title: Site Engineer

Location: Sizewell

Duration: 12 months

Responsibilities
  • Conduct site surveys and produce detailed plans and drawings
  • Set out and ensure accuracy and compliance with plans and specifications
  • Liaise with project managers, engineers, and contractors to ensure timely completion of work
  • Monitor and maintain quality control procedures and ensure compliance with health and safety regulations
  • Provide ongoing support throughout the project as needed
Requirements
  • Experience working in a rail environment and preferably a PTS
  • Relevant qualifications and experience in setting out
  • Proficient in the use of setting out equipment, surveying software, and CAD software
  • Knowledge of health and safety regulations and compliance requirements
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team
